By default it chooses the best viewer found in $PATH, trying (in this order):
`info`, `man`, `$PAGER`, `less`, `more`.
You can force the use of info, man, or a pager with the `-i`, `-m`, or `-p` flags,
If no viewer can be found, or the command is run non-interactively, it just prints
the manual to stdout.
If using `info`, note that version 6 or greater is needed for TOPIC lookup. If you are
on mac you will likely have info 4.8, and should consider installing a newer version,
eg with `brew install texinfo` (#1770).
